Log siding replacement services involve removing existing log or wood siding and installing new material to restore the appearance and integrity of a property's exterior. This process typically includes carefully removing damaged or deteriorated siding, preparing the underlying surface, and installing fresh siding that matches the style and finish of the original. Skilled contractors ensure that the new siding is properly fitted and sealed to protect the structure from weather elements, helping to improve both the look and durability of the property’s exterior.

This service is often sought when existing siding has become compromised due to rot, insect damage, warping, or fading. Over time, exposure to moisture and sunlight can cause logs or wood siding to deteriorate, leading to issues such as cracking, splitting, or mold growth. Replacing the siding can effectively address these problems, preventing further damage and re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line. It also enhances the property's curb appeal, making it a practical solution for homeowners looking to maintain or increase their home's value.

Log siding replacement is commonly used on a variety of properties, including historic homes, cabins, cottages, and rural residences. These types of buildings often feature log or wood siding as a key architectural element, and maintaining their original charm is important to many homeowners. Additionally, properties in areas with high humidity or frequent weather changes may benefit from siding replacement to ensure the exterior remains weather-resistant and structurally sound over time.

The overview below groups typical Log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Colchester,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or log siding repairs in Colchester range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ged logs,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end for more extensive patching or localized work.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of log siding us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500 depending on the size and complexity.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this range, with larger or more intricate jobs reaching higher costs.

Full Log Siding Replacement - Complete replacement of all log siding can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more. Most full projects in the area tend to fall in the middle of this range, while very large or custom jobs can exceed $20,000.

Material and Design Variations - The choice of materials and design features can influence costs significantly. Typical projects vary widely, with standard options often costing less and premium or custom designs pushing prices higher, depending on the scope and specifications of the job.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are log siding replacement services? Log siding replacement involves removing damaged or aging logs and installing new logs to restore the appearance and integrity of a property's exterior.

Why might someone need log siding replacement? Log siding may need replacement due to rot, insect damage, warping, or general wear over time that affects the home's durability and appearance.

How do local contractors handle log siding replacement projects? Local service providers assess the condition of existing logs, recommend suitable replacement options, and perform the installation to match the property's style.

What types of logs are used in replacement projects? Service providers typically offer various log materials, such as cedar, pine, or engineered logs, to meet aesthetic preferences and longevity needs.

Is log siding replacement suitable for all types of homes? Log siding replacement can be performed on many homes with log exteriors, but it's best to consult with local contractors to determine the most appropriate solution for each property.
